EDITORS COMMENTS
This lithograph, titled "Pictish Woman" transports us back in time to the mysterious world of ancient Scotland. Created by John White in the late 16th century, this print showcases his remarkable talent for capturing intricate details and bringing historical figures to life. In the image, we see a Pictish woman adorned with an array of fascinating elements that reflect her culture and identity. Her striking costume features a beautifully patterned cloth draped over her shoulder, while a belt cinches her waist. A crescent-shaped necklace adorns her neck, adding an air of elegance to her ensemble. The woman's body is decorated with elaborate tattoos that tell stories and symbolize important aspects of Pictish society. She holds both a sword and spear, suggesting she possesses strength and skill as a warrior. The star-shaped body decoration further emphasizes her connection to celestial forces. Every element in this lithograph has been meticulously engraved, showcasing White's attention to detail. From the intricately painted designs on the woman's clothing to the fine lines etched into each weapon, every aspect contributes to creating an authentic representation of Pictish culture.
